This program:

#include <stdio.h>
#include <pthread.h>

int g_8 = 1;
int g_140;
int *g_139 = &g_140;
int **g_138 = &g_139;
int g_182;

void func_2 (p1) {
  **g_138 = 0;
}

int func_11 (int p1, int p2, int p3, int p4) {
  if (g_8)
    return 0;
  ++g_182;
  return 0;
}

void *context (void *ptr) {
  g_182 = 1;
  printf ("%d\n",g_182);
}

void main () {
  pthread_t thread1;
  int  iret1;
  iret1 = pthread_create( &thread1, NULL, context, (void*) 0);

  func_2 (func_11 (0, 0, 0, 0) );

  pthread_join( thread1, NULL);
}

is miscompiled by gcc --param allow-store-data-races=0 -O2 (or -O3) on x86_64.

[ gcc version 4.8.0 20121011 (experimental) (GCC) ]

The program has no data-races because the ++g_182 instruction in func_11 is
never executed by the main thread, and the context thread is expected to always
print 1.

The -O2 and -O3 optimisers (invoked with --param allow-store-data-races=0)
compile main as:

main:
        subq    $24, %rsp
        xorl    %ecx, %ecx
        xorl    %esi, %esi
        leaq    8(%rsp), %rdi
        movl    $context, %edx
        call    pthread_create

        xorl    %eax, %eax
        cmpl    $1, g_8(%rip)
        movq    8(%rsp), %rdi
        setb    %al
(**)    addl    %eax, g_182(%rip)
        movq    g_138(%rip), %rax

        xorl    %esi, %esi
        movq    (%rax), %rax
        movl    $0, (%rax)
        call    pthread_join
        addq    $24, %rsp
        ret

The problem is in the (**) instruction:

      addl    %eax, g_182(%rip)

which inserts a write of the value 0 in the run-time trace of the main thread,
possibly resulting in the context thread printing 0.
